Drug Rehabilitation and Detoxification for Withdrawal Symptoms

One of the reasons drug addicted individuals find it difficult to stop using drugs once they start using them, is because of physical and psychological dependency that inevitably occurs when the person uses them long enough. It no longer becomes a matter of "willpower" because their bodies and minds will actually produce extremely uncomfortable withdrawal symptoms if they stop using drugs. This is called drug withdrawal, and is a major roadblock for people who wish to stop using drugs. Individuals often become very ill during withdrawal and can even die in in some cases, as seizures and strokes can occur with certain drugs and with alcohol. Depression is a very typical withdrawal symptom, which can become so severe that an individual may commit suicide.

To relieve certain withdrawal symptoms and to make detoxification a safer process, it is suggested that addicts who wish to quit do so in the proper atmosphere such as a drug rehab facility. Drug treatment facilities in Lincoln can not only medically monitor the person through the detoxification process and help minimize and relieve withdrawal symptoms, but also ensure that the individual doesn't relapse back into drug use. After detoxification has been accomplished, treatment professionals in Lincoln will then ensure that all underlying psychological and emotional issues tied to the person's addiction are confronted and resolved so that they stay off of drugs once they leave the drug rehabilitation facility.

How Much Does a Drug Treatment Program Cost?

It can be difficult enough to get someone to want help and agree to enter a drug rehab facility in Lincoln. Digging up the money to pay for drug treatment can often be a problem, but one that can be overcome if one looks at the many options available in Lincoln. Depending on which drug rehab option is chosen, the cost of drug rehab can vary considerably from program to program. Some outpatient and short term drug treatment facilitiescenters]]] for example may be state or federally funded and may even be free of charge. These types of facilities are also usually the least effective however, a fact which should be considered over cost.

More long term drug rehabilitation centers in Lincoln which have proven to be the most effective are residential and inpatient drug treatment programs which require a stay of at least 90 days. These types of drug rehabilitation programs are typically more costly due to the fact that these facilities are private drug treatment facilities and provide their clients with all food and shelter for the duration of their stay. These programs typically cost anywhere from $4000 to $20,000, depending on the length of stay and the amenities offered.

Types of Drug Recovery Programs

Drug Recovery Detox - Detox is not in itself a full Drug Treatment Program. Detoxification commonly takes place as an inpatient hospitalization that lasts about 7-10 days. The main purpose of drug detoxification is to eliminate all traces of a drug while at the same time minimizing dangerous withdrawal symptoms. Recent studies on drug abuse have concluded that when addicted individuals have tried to use detoxification by itself as a form of treatment, the results were the same as in those that had no professional rehabilitation at all.

Outpatient Drug Recovery Treatment- This type of part-time recovery is often used for moderate drug users, who are unable to go to a Drug Rehab Program in Lincoln for various reasons. In this type of Drug Rehab, the particular person usually attends some hours of group and individual counseling every day, and returns to their home at night and on the weekends.

Residential Drug Recovery Treatment - In this type of Lincoln Drug Treatment Program, the person resides at the rehabilitation center, and they are able to focus solely on their addiction, with no interruptions. Cognitive, emotional, and behavioral therapies concentrate on providing positive alternatives for identifying and solving one's problems. This variety of drug recovery program in Lincoln, Kansas offers relapse prevention strategies, substance abuse education classes, practical life skills, and social education to assist the individual in reaching the goal of long term recovery. Professionals in the field of substance abuse have concluded that residential treatment offers the most effective long term results in contrast to any other type of drug recovery treatment.
